When it comes to high-stakes casino marketing, maximizing engagement is crucial to attract and retain players. One major strategy is to leverage personalized marketing through data-driven insights. By analyzing player behavior, casinos can create targeted promotions that resonate with their audience. Additionally, implementing loyalty programs that reward high-rollers can generate further interest and commitment. Using tools like email segmentation and tailored ads can amplify your reach while ensuring that your messages hit the right notes.
Another essential strategy is to host exclusive events that appeal to elite players. These events can range from private tournaments to VIP nights featuring celebrity guests. Promoting these events through social media and influencer partnerships can significantly widen your audience. Incorporating interactive content, such as live Q&A sessions or behind-the-scenes looks, can also enhance engagement. Remember, when players feel valued and part of an exclusive community, they are more likely to return and share their positive experiences with others.

The psychology of high rollers reveals a complex interplay of motivation, risk perception, and social dynamics that drives their betting behavior. These individuals are often characterized by their desire for excitement and the thrill of winning big. The high stakes environment can trigger an adrenaline rush similar to that experienced in extreme sports or high-pressure situations. For many, this excitement outweighs the potential for loss, as they see gambling not merely as a game of chance but as a calculated risk that could yield significant rewards.
Another crucial factor influencing high rollers' betting behavior is the social validation they receive from their gambling activities. Engaging in high-stakes betting often places them in elite social circles where winning is celebrated, and losses are downplayed. This dynamic fosters a sense of belonging and prestige, aligning their self-worth with their betting outcomes. Furthermore, high rollers frequently use gambling as a means to escape from their daily routines, seeking not just financial gain but also a sense of freedom and adventure that comes from taking risks, often under the spotlight of public admiration.
In today's highly competitive gaming landscape, it's crucial for casinos to continually assess their marketing strategies. Is your casino's marketing strategy missing the mark? One of the primary indicators to monitor is the overall engagement rate across various channels. If your social media posts receive minimal interaction or your email open rates are dwindling, it may be a sign that your messaging isn't resonating with your audience. Consider conducting A/B testing on your campaigns to find out which approaches lead to higher engagement. Additionally, pay attention to customer feedback and reviews, as they can provide valuable insights into your marketing effectiveness.
Another critical indicator is your customer acquisition cost (CAC). If your expenses to attract new players are significantly rising without a corresponding increase in player retention or lifetime value, then something is amiss. Evaluate your advertising channels: Are you investing heavily in promotional tactics that yield low conversion rates? Utilize analytics tools to track the performance of different campaigns, and focus on strategies that deliver the best ROI. Remember, a strategic overhaul may be necessary if any of these warning signs are evident—don't let your marketing efforts fall flat in an industry that thrives on attraction and retention.
